Łukasz Pieniążek (born 19 September 1990) is a Polish rally driver.{{cite web|title=Łukasz Pieniążek|url=https://www.ewrc-results.com/profile/73062-lukasz-pieniazek/|website=e-wrc.com|accessdate=24 May 2019}} Currently, He drives for M-Sport Ford in the WRC-2 Pro category.

Rally career

Pieniążek made his WRC debut at 2016 Rally de Portugal, driving a Citroën DS3 R3T Max in the WRC-3 and J-WRC categories.{{Cite web|url=http://www.ewrc-results.com/final.php?e=27503&t=Vodafone-Rally-de-Portugal-2016|title=Vodafone Rally de Portugal 2016|website=e-wrc.com|accessdate=13 December 2016}} One year later, he was promoted to the WRC-2 category.{{cite web|title=Tour de Corse Entry List|url=http://www.tourdecorse.com/site/download/official_documents_uk/entry_list/Che-Guevara-Energy-Drink-Tour-de-Corse-2017-Entry-List-FIA-Approved.pdf|website=tourdecorse.com|accessdate=17 March 2017|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20170318003201/http://www.tourdecorse.com/site/download/official_documents_uk/entry_list/Che-Guevara-Energy-Drink-Tour-de-Corse-2017-Entry-List-FIA-Approved.pdf|archive-date=18 March 2017|url-status=dead|df=dmy-all}}

At 2018 Rally de Portugal, he scored his first WRC points, finishing ninth in the overall standings.{{cite news|url=http://www.wrc.com/en/wrc/news/may-2018/portugal-breaking/page/5467--12-12-.html|title=Breaking News: Neuville Wins In Portugal|work=wrc.com|publisher=WRC|date=20 May 2018|accessdate=20 May 2018}} The rally was also his first-ever podium finish in the WRC-2 championship.{{cite news|url=https://www.wrc.com/en/wrc-2/news/2018/may-2018/wrc-2-portugal-sunday/page/5468--51-51-.html|title=WRC 2 in Portugal: Tidemand takes comfortable win|work=wrc.com|publisher=WRC|date=20 May 2018|accessdate=17 May 2019}}

On January 10, 2019, it was confirmed by M-Sport Ford that Pieniążek would contest for selected events in the newly created WRC-2 Pro championship.{{cite news|url=https://www.m-sport.co.uk/single-post/2019/01/10/M-SPORT-FORD-CONFIRM-GREENSMITH-AND-PIENIAZEK-FOR-WRC-2-PRO|title=M-Sport Ford Confirm Greensmith and Pieniazek for WRC-2 Pro|work=M-Sport.co.uk|date=10 January 2019|accessdate=10 January 2019}} In Guanajuato and Corsica, he won the Pro class.{{cite news|url=https://www.wrc.com/en/wrc-2/news/2019/march-2019/wrc-2-mexico-sunday/page/6179--51-51-.html|title=WRC 2 in Mexico: Guerra takes first home victory|work=wrc.com|publisher=WRC|date=11 March 2019|accessdate=11 March 2019}}{{cite news|url=https://www.wrc.com/en/wrc-2/news/2019/march-2019/corsica-sunday-wrap/page/6237--51-51-.html|title=WRC 2 in Corsica: Andolfi wins after Sunday Thriller|work=wrc.com|publisher=WRC|date=31 March 2019|accessdate=1 April 2019}}
